Last week I was lucky enough to deliver 2 very different wedding books. These are, by far, my favorite product offered by Ansley Studio.

The coffee-table books I offer are unmatched in print quality and craftsmanship. The book covers are made with masonite to make the books smooth, sturdy, and offer lasting protection.

The 110# weight hinged paper lays flat and comes with a UV coating to protect the images for a lifetime. The books are completely acid-free & archival.

They are rated to last 100 years when keep in a cool dry place away from direct sunlight and 200 years when keep in a cool dark space such as a box or desk.

They are also custom-designed by an artist to tell the story of the entire wedding day.

Accordion Mini-Books are available on all of our paper options: standard semi-gloss, art linen, art watercolor, art recycled, and pearl. UV coating can also be added for added protection and longevity. Cover options include fabrics, leathers, suedes, or a personalized custom photo cover in lustre or metallic with a matte laminate. The Accordion Mini-Books have up to 14 customizable panels and frosted slip-covers are an easy add-on for even greater protection from what hides in your purse. Ansley Studio has always worked to ensure the fine art portraits we produce will last beyond our lifetime. We’ve also worked to be the best green business we can. Owner & Master Photographer Ansley Simmons uses digital media to cut down on chemical use, only purchases rechargeable batteries for our equipment, uses electronic delivery for proofing images as well as online marketing, reduces paper waste by reading online, and encourages our clients to only print the photos they want to display – all traditions started on day one in 2006.

Today, we’re joining forces with a print company in California to offer eco-friendly specialty products. Now when you order a gallery wrapped canvas of you and your sweetheart, a ChromaLux display of your favorite wedding image, or an aluminum metal print of your funky teen, you can proudly say it was produced under the greenest conditions currently offered. Our wood comes from USA reforestable farms, we never use OBA (or bleached) canvas, and our coatings are non-solvent and biodegradable.
